At the end of 2025, two South Dakotans who were two long-time collegiate teachers, leaders and football coaches were interviewed about their faith and lives. A native of Lebanon and Faulkton, Jim Kretchman was an All-American running back at Northern State University in Aberdeen. He went on to teach, coach and become NSU’s athletic director. A native of Selby and a former NSU assistant coach, John Stiegelmeier is a South Dakota State University graduate who went on to become that school’s all-time winningest football coach. Both men captured numerous honors and championships. They were interviewed by Aberdeen residents Steve Graf and Arne Svarstad.
